Ticket: Consent banner config drift on Brimveil plugin hosts

Plugin authors: during the staged rollout of the Brimveil consent banner, several plugin sandboxes picked up stale banner settings from the old Quillgate provisioning path. This means locale lists and revocation timeouts may differ from what the platform docs describe. Drift only affects sandboxes created before the rollout; new ones are correct. Please validate your integrations against the canonical settings. The current values your plugins should expect are as follows.

config for kafof-bawef:
holath:
  log_level: debug
  metrics_host: metrics.holath.qorvelsys.internal
  pin: 2191
  pool_size: 32

Title: vramscope reports negative allocation deltas after device reset

The Orvane vramscope profiler miscounts GPU memory when the driver resets mid-capture, producing negative deltas that corrupt downstream reports. Future maintainers: the counter baseline must be re-snapshotted on every reset event, not just at capture start. Repro requires the Bellhurst test rig. The affected build is identified by the token below.

pipeline stamp: htk3_cc5

Reception team — reminder that Lift B at Harrowgate Court is reserved for deliveries only from 08:00 to 12:00 daily. Do not send visitors up in it during that window. Couriers using the lift must key in at the panel beside the doors. The current lift code is as follows.

door code, fawef-faduf: bdg-JVUCQ-8

// Heads up: this fixture generates a 40k-row spreadsheet export to stress
// the Tabulon streaming writer. Don't bump the row count casually — the old
// buffered path ballooned to 2GB of heap and this test exists to keep that
// from sneaking back. Runs against the Quillport staging export API, so it
// needs network access in CI. The request authenticates with the token below.

session JWT of yawep-yawep = eyJhbGciOiJIUzI1NiIsInR5cCI6IkpXVCJ9.eyJzdWIiOiI3pWF3_In0.aXYsHiog